Beispiel #1
0
 }
 echo '
     </div>
 </div>
 <hr>
 <div class="container">
     <div class="row">
         <div class="col-xs-12 col-md-9">
             <table class="table" id="good">
                 <thead>
                     <tr><th>Nome</th><th>Ordine</th><th>Creato da</th><th>Discussioni</th></tr>
                 </thead>
                 <tbody>';
 $utenti = $dati['database']->select("persone", array("id", "nome"), array("ORDER" => "id"));
 $categorie = $dati['database']->select("categorie", "*", array("ORDER" => "id"));
 $numero = pieni($categorie, "tipo");
 $results = $dati['database']->select("tipi", "*");
 if ($results != null) {
     foreach ($results as $result) {
         if ($result["stato"] == 0) {
             if (isset($numero[$result["id"]]) && $numero[$result["id"]] != null) {
                 $cont = $numero[$result["id"]];
             } else {
                 $cont = 0;
             }
             echo '
                     <tr>
                         <td>
                             <span class="hidden" id="value">' . $result["id"] . '</span>
                             <a href="' . $dati['info']['root'] . 'tipo/' . $result["id"] . '">' . $result["nome"] . '</a>
                             <span class="badge">' . $cont . ' categorie</span>';
Beispiel #2
0
if (isAdminUserAutenticate() && isset($reset) && !isAdmin($dati['database'], $reset)) {
    $password = random(5);
    $name = $dati['database']->get('persone', 'nome', array('id' => $reset));
    $username = str_replace(" ", "", strtolower($name));
    if (strlen($username) > 200) {
        $username = substr($username, 0, 200);
    }
    while (!isUserFree($dati['database'], $username, $reset)) {
        $username .= rand(0, 999);
    }
    $dati['database']->update('persone', array('username' => $username, 'password' => $password, 'email' => '', 'stato' => 0, 'verificata' => 0), array('AND' => array('id' => $reset, 'stato[!]' => 0)));
    echo 'Username: '******' - Password: '******'database']->select('scuole', '*', array('ORDER' => 'id'));
    $accessi = $dati['database']->select('accessi', '*');
    $numero = pieni($accessi, 'id');
    $permessi = $dati['database']->select('permessi', '*', array('ORDER' => 'persona'));
    $studenti = $dati['database']->select('studenti', '*', array('id' => $dati['database']->max('studenti', 'id'), 'ORDER' => 'persona'));
    $classi = $dati['database']->select('classi', '*', array('ORDER' => 'id'));
    $results = $dati['database']->select('persone', '*', array('ORDER' => 'nome'));
    $pageTitle = 'Utenti registrati';
    require_once 'templates/shared/header.php';
    echo '
            <div class="jumbotron green">
                <div class="container text-center">
                    <h1><i class="fa fa-user-secret"></i> ' . $pageTitle . '</h1>
                </div>
            </div>
            <div class="jumbotron">
                <div class="container">
                <p>Elenco utenti registrati</p>
Beispiel #3
0
 require_once 'templates/shared/header.php';
 echo '
 <div class="jumbotron">
     <div class="container text-center">
         <h1><i class="fa fa-commenting-o fa-1x"></i> ' . $pageTitle . '</h1>
         <p>Elenco articoli globali</p>
     </div>
 </div>
 <hr>
 <div class="container">';
 if (isset($user)) {
     $datas = $dati['database']->select("posts", array("id", "articolo"), array("creatore" => $user));
 } else {
     $datas = $dati['database']->select("posts", array("id", "articolo"));
 }
 $numero = pieni($datas, "articolo");
 if ($results != null) {
     echo '
     <div class="list-group">';
     foreach ($results as $result) {
         if (isset($numero[$result["id"]]) && $numero[$result["id"]] != null) {
             $cont = $numero[$result["id"]];
         } else {
             $cont = 0;
         }
         echo '
         <a href="' . $dati['info']['root'] . 'posts/' . $result["id"];
         if (!isset($user)) {
             echo '/tutti';
         }
         echo '" class="list-group-item"><span class="badge">' . $cont . ' post</span>' . $result["nome"] . '</a>';
Beispiel #4
0
     echo 0;
 } else {
     $pageTitle = "Corsi disponibili";
     $datatable = true;
     $readmore = true;
     require_once 'shared/header.php';
     $scuola = scuola($dati['database'], $dati["user"]);
     if (isAdminUserAutenticate()) {
         $results = $dati['database']->select("corsi", "*", array("AND" => array("autogestione" => $autogestione, "quando[!]" => null)));
     } else {
         $results = $dati['database']->select("corsi", "*", array("AND" => array("autogestione" => $autogestione, "scuola" => $scuola, "quando[!]" => null, "stato" => 0)));
     }
     $scuole = $dati['database']->select("scuole", "*", array("ORDER" => "id"));
     $utenti = $dati['database']->select("persone", array("id", "nome"), array("ORDER" => "id"));
     $iscritti = $dati['database']->select("iscrizioni", "*", array("ORDER" => "corso"));
     $numero = pieni($iscritti);
     $iscrizioni = io($iscritti, $dati["user"], 0);
     $interessato = io($iscritti, $dati["user"], 1);
     $occupato = "";
     if ($results != null) {
         foreach ($results as $result) {
             if (inside($iscrizioni, $result["id"])) {
                 if (strlen($occupato) > 0) {
                     $occupato .= ",";
                 }
                 $occupato .= $result["quando"];
             }
         }
     }
     $infos = $dati['database']->select("autogestioni", "*", array("id" => $autogestione, "LIMIT" => 1));
     echo '
Beispiel #5
0
         <h1><i class="fa fa-comments-o fa-1x"></i> ' . $pageTitle . '</h1>
         <p>Elenco <span id="page">articoli</span> disponibili</p>
         <a href="' . $dati['info']['root'] . 'nuovo/articolo" class="btn btn-primary">Nuovo articolo</a></div>
 </div>
 <hr>
 <div class="container">
     <div class="row">
         <div class="col-xs-12 col-md-9">
             <table class="table" id="good">
                 <thead>
                     <tr><th>Nome</th><th>Ordine</th><th>Creato da</th><th>Risposte</th></tr>
                 </thead>
                 <tbody>';
 $utenti = $dati['database']->select("persone", array("id", "nome"), array("ORDER" => "id"));
 $posts = $dati['database']->select("posts", "*", array("ORDER" => "id"));
 $numero = pieni($posts, "articolo");
 $results = $dati['database']->select("articoli", "*");
 if ($results != null) {
     foreach ($results as $result) {
         if ($result["stato"] == 0) {
             if (isset($numero[$result["id"]]) && $numero[$result["id"]] != null) {
                 $cont = $numero[$result["id"]];
             } else {
                 $cont = 0;
             }
             echo '
                     <tr>
                         <td>
                             <span class="hidden" id="value">' . $result["id"] . '</span>
                             <a href="' . $dati['info']['root'] . 'articolo/' . $result["id"] . '">' . $result["nome"] . '</a>
                             <span class="badge">' . $cont . ' post</span>';
Beispiel #6
0
         if (isAdminUserAutenticate()) {
             $results = $dati['database']->select("citazioni", "*");
         } else {
             $results = $dati['database']->select("citazioni", "*", array("stato" => "0"));
         }
     } else {
         if (isAdminUserAutenticate()) {
             $results = $dati['database']->select("citazioni", "*", array("prof" => $view));
         } else {
             $results = $dati['database']->select("citazioni", "*", array("AND" => array("prof" => $view, "stato" => "0")));
         }
     }
     $profs = $dati['database']->select("profs", array("id", "nome"), array("ORDER" => "id"));
     $utenti = $dati['database']->select("persone", array("id", "nome"), array("ORDER" => "id"));
     $iscritti = $dati['database']->select("voti", "*", array("ORDER" => "citazione"));
     $numero = pieni($iscritti, "citazione");
     $iscrizioni = io($iscritti, $dati["user"], -1, "citazione");
     echo '<div class="jumbotron">
 <div class="container text-center">
     <h1><i class="fa fa-quote-left fa-1x"></i> Citazioni <span id="who">';
     if (isset($view) && ricerca($profs, $view) != -1) {
         echo ' di ' . $profs[ricerca($profs, $view)]["nome"] . '!';
     }
     echo '</span></h1>';
     if (!isset($view)) {
         echo '
     <p>Le migliori <span id="page">citazioni</span> dei professori, inserite dagli studenti e curate dai Rappresentanti</p>';
     }
     echo '
     <a href="' . $dati['info']['root'] . 'citazione" class="btn btn-primary">Nuova citazione</a>
 </div>
Beispiel #7
0
     <a href="' . $dati['info']['root'] . 'aula" class="btn btn-primary">Nuova <span id="page">aula</span> studio</a>
 </div>
 <div class="container">
     <table class="table datatable table-borderless">
         <thead>
             <tr><th>Nome</th></tr>
         </thead>
         <tbody>';
         if (isAdminUserAutenticate()) {
             $results = $dati['database']->select("aule", "*");
         } else {
             $results = $dati['database']->select("aule", "*", array("stato" => "0"));
         }
         $utenti = $dati['database']->select("persone", array("id", "nome"), array("ORDER" => "id"));
         $iscritti = $dati['database']->select("pomeriggio", "*", array("ORDER" => "aula"));
         $numero = pieni($iscritti, "aula");
         $iscrizioni = io($iscritti, $dati["user"], 0, "aula");
         $interessato = io($iscritti, $dati["user"], 1, "aula");
         if ($results != null) {
             foreach ($results as $key => $result) {
                 $cont = 0;
                 if ($result["id"] - $numero[0] >= 0 && $numero[1] - $result["id"] >= 0 && $numero[2][$result["id"] - $numero[0]] != "") {
                     $cont = $numero[2][$result["id"] - $numero[0]];
                 }
                 if ($result["stato"] == 0 && (inside($iscrizioni, $result["id"]) || $cont < $result["max"]) && strtotime($result["data"]) > strtotime("now")) {
                     echo '
             <tr>
                 <td>
                     <sectionlight-grey">
                         <h3><a href="' . $dati['info']['root'] . 'aula/' . $result["id"] . '">' . $result["nome"] . '</a></h3>';
                     if (isAdminUserAutenticate()) {
Beispiel #8
0
 }
 echo '
     </div>
 </div>
 <hr>
 <div class="container">
     <div class="row">
         <div class="col-xs-12 col-md-9">
             <table class="table" id="good">
                 <thead>
                     <tr><th>Nome</th><th>Ordine</th><th>Creato da</th><th></th>Articoli</tr>
                 </thead>
                 <tbody>';
 $utenti = $dati['database']->select("persone", array("id", "nome"), array("ORDER" => "id"));
 $articoli = $dati['database']->select("articoli", "*", array("stato[!]" => 1, "ORDER" => "id"));
 $numero = pieni($articoli, "categoria");
 $results = $dati['database']->select("categorie", "*");
 if ($results != null) {
     foreach ($results as $result) {
         if ($result["stato"] == 0) {
             if (isset($numero[$result["id"]]) && $numero[$result["id"]] != null) {
                 $cont = $numero[$result["id"]];
             } else {
                 $cont = 0;
             }
             echo '
                     <tr>
                         <td>
                             <span class="hidden" id="value">' . $result["id"] . '</span>
                             <a href="' . $dati['info']['root'] . 'categoria/' . $result["id"] . '">' . $result["nome"] . '</a>
                             <span class="badge">' . $cont . ' articoli</span>';